They tried this with templates and super squished scaling during legion, and to some extent during BFA. The templates were gone in BFA but scaling was there.
Players largely didn’t like it and we had all time low arena participation. It turns out that people like gearing / having gear progression in WoW PVP. The problem right now is that the difference between low end and high end pvp gear is completely and utterly ridiculous.
I’d be fine if we went back to MoP gearing where you got your purple, and it was your BiS until next season. Later in the season you could full gear an alt in a day or two, you got the feeling of progression and powering up, and then you were good to go. I level capped and full geared every class in the game in MoP S15 and it was probably the most fun i ever had with WoW.
Anyway, i think a happy medium is to have reasonably accessible pvp gear that doesn’t have numerous levels to upgrade and massive ilvl gaps based on rating. We don’t need artificial scaling if we go back to a MoP style gearing system.
